The Office of the Surveyor-General is the government authority on the cadastre (land property boundaries and tenure), cadastral surveying legislation, foundation spatial data, geographic place names, roads opening and closing and positioning and geodetic surveying infrastructure.
The role and responsibilities of the Surveyor-General include:
- Setting cadastral survey practice standards and monitoring compliance
- positioning infrastructure and geodetic surveying
- integrity of land property boundaries and tenure
- land administration
- foundation spatial data
- roads opening and closing
- place name proposals
- geographic place names
- Adelaide Park Lands Plan
- leadership role within the profession.
